Hi Tip it community,

 

Just wondering, I have a question on which 99 skill I should achieve. I am looking for the most fastest and productive out of these 4 skills. The skills are Fletching, Cooking, Thieving, and Firemaking. I have a low amount of cash, about 2M, but I could make some more.

Go for thieving.. It is very fast using Pyramid Plunder, will cost you no money (besides food, anti-poisons, ect.), and is usually less common than Fletching or Cooking..
